Shop ethically this festive season: create a positive impact in your community

November 28, 2024

Est min

As the festive season approaches, many of us are seeking thoughtful, meaningful gifts that align with our values.

To help make your holiday shopping easier and more ethical, we’ve curated a list of sustainable, socially conscious businesses through careful research.

These businesses prioritise fair trade, eco-friendly practices, and giving back to their communities.

List of ethical places to buy gifts this festive season

Buy Social Scotland

From organic chocolate to fabulous experience days, this directory makes it easy to find great ethical gifts from Scotland’s Social Enterprises.

Ethically gifted

Homewares to handbags; browse for any gift you care to imagine. All are made by the most skilled Fair Trade artisans and ethical producers.

Wellbox

Sustainable, eco-friendly corporate gift boxes.

This is more directed at organisations gifting B-to-B, or buying boxes for employees.

Social Supermarket

Shop their range of sustainable e-gift boxes, with every item chosen for its minimal impact on the environment.

Ethical superstore

Shop this online supermarket for gifts for your green-fingered pals, tasty treats for your vegan friends, and every festive accessory you will ever need. Great buys to be had if you have a limited budget too.

The Ethical Shop

This online store collaborates with ethical, eco-friendly, and Fair Trade suppliers to provide a great range of gifts. Look out for the supplier of the month feature too.

One World Shop

Everything in their (gift idea) collection is ethically produced, eco-friendly, or made from sustainable sources. A very welcome free gift-wrapping service is included too.

Green Tulip

With ethically sourced presents to suit every occasion and an extensive range of natural cleaning supplies, this site is for anyone wishing to indulge their passion for greener living.

VEO x Worth

Worth and Veo are two ethical shopping powerhouses that joined forces to make sustainable lifestyles accessible to everyone. Shop everything from sustainable fashion to natural holistic health and wellness products.
